UNIQUE EXPERIENCE

BABY BORN IN BUS.

(By Telegraph—Press Association.)

ROTORUA. September 25.

A healthy baby was born in unique circumstances on Saturday afternoon. The mother, a Maori woman, had ridden by bus to Rotorua for a medical consultation. ' The conclusion was that the happy event was a week distant. The mother was returning home to Rotoiti by bus when the birth took place. A woman passenger took charge of the child. The mother was made as comfortable as possible and taken safely home, together with the baby, who also seemed quite well.
